    Paris Saint-Germain - Malmö FF (15 septembre 2015)
    Shakhtar Donetsk - Paris Saint-Germain (30 septembre 2015)
    Paris Saint-Germain - Real Madrid (21 octobre 2015)
    Real Madrid - Paris Saint-Germain (3 novembre 2015)
    Malmö FF - Paris Saint-Germain (25 novembre 2015)
    Paris Saint-Germain - Shakhtar Donetsk (8 décembre 2015)
